A Withdrawn Standard is one, which is removed from sale, and its unique number can no longer be used. The Standard can be withdrawn and not replaced, or it can be withdrawn and replaced by a Standard with a different number.

Design of articles to be coated by anodic oxidation in the light of the nature of the processes involved in anodizing metal articles and prime features of an anodized finish. Gives typical applications for finished articles and illustrates preferred and deprecated design features.
